What happens when the garden you love starts demanding more than you can give? In today's episode of Roots and All, I'm joined by garden writer Rhonda Fleming Hayes to explore how gardening changes as we age — from adapting high-maintenance spaces to embracing balcony gardens, community plots and slower, more meaningful ways of connecting with nature.
